Google Faces Potential Forced Sale of Chrome Browser by US Justice Department

The US Justice Department is considering forcing Google to sell its Chrome web browser as part of a potential antitrust lawsuit against the tech giant. Authorities are concerned about Google’s dominance in the online advertising market and its ability to prioritize its own digital services over competitors’. The potential lawsuit could also target Google’s advertising technology business and its bundling of services like Gmail, Maps, and YouTube with Android. Google has long faced scrutiny over its market power, with critics arguing it has stifled competition. The company maintains that its services are beneficial to consumers and that people have choices. If the Justice Department proceeds with the lawsuit, it could lead to one of the biggest antitrust cases against a tech company in decades.
